If ever there was a time for the classic "circle the wagons" game, this is it.  Rosiak hit all the key points in his article today.  Hopefully MU gets back to doing what won the CBE Classic--play uptempo, get to the basket, and force turnovers.  I agree with everybody here that we can't get into a shooting contest with any of these BE teams. 
Aside from our subpar shooting %, I think the key to the rest of this season will be defensive rebounding.  I went to the Providence game, and watching the Syracuse game--WAY too many 2nd shots allowed.  If we can limit teams to one shot per trip, we'll get back on track.
